Blueberry (comic)

Blueberry is a French comic strip created by Jean-Michel Charlier and Jean "Mœbius" Giraud. It chronicles the adventures of Mike Blueberry on his travels through the American Old West.

Blueberry has its roots in Giraud's earlier Western-themed works such as Frank et Jeremie, which was drawn for Far West magazine when he was only 18, and Jerry Spring, a 1961 strip that appeared in five issues of Spirou. Charlier and Giraud have also collaborated on another Western strip, Jim Cutlass.

The story follows Michael Steven Donovan, nicknamed "Blueberry", starting with his adventures as a Lieutenant in the United States Cavalry shortly after the American Civil War. He is accompanied in many tales by his hard-drinking deputy, Jimmy.

Blueberry began in the 31 October, 1963 issue of Pilote magazine. That first serial, "Fort Navaho", grew into 46 pages over the next few issues. Charlier and Giraud continued to add to the legend of Mike Blueberry in Pilote and other titles even into the 1990s. During that time the artistic style has varied greatly, much as with Giraud's other works. In the same volume, sweeping landscapes will contrast sharply with hard-edged action scenes and the art matches the changing mood of the story quite well. Like much of the Western genre, Blueberry touches on the constant conflict between violence and tranquility, nature and civilization, and the obligation of the strong to protect the weak. In addition to the comic strips, Blueberry and his fellow characters can be found on posters, clothing, and other items.

A "prequel" series, Young Blueberry, has been published as well.

A few companies, particularly Epic Comics and Mojo Press, have released collections of English translations of the Blueberry strips and stories. Opinions are mixed on these, as sometimes the artwork is shrunk to fit smaller book formats, and in the case of the first Mojo Press collection Blueberry: Confederate Gold (ISBN 1885418086), printed in black and white. The hardbound collections by Graphitti Designs are generally considered to be the best available to English-speaking fans, especially as they feature additional material and commentary by Giraud, but are difficult to find due to limited print runs.
